| Parameter | Details / Expected Values | Repair Notes & Context | | :--- | :--- | :--- | | | 12V (Typical). Measured on pins A13V, Q211, Q400 . | This is the main supply. Its absence suggests a problem upstream on the main power supply or motherboard. | | Core Output Voltages | VCC CORE : 1.8V VDD : 1.9V VDDIO : 3.3V | These are always-on, basic logic voltages. When present, they indicate the IC is receiving power and a basic EN1 (Enable 1) signal. | | Panel Drive Voltages | VGH : 25V - 28V VGL : -5V to -10V HAVDD / AVDD | A failure in one or more of these outputs commonly points to a faulty VPMS2SM, a shorted component on its output line, or a defective LCD panel itself. | | Programming & Control | The VPMS2SM is a digitally programmable device. It is controlled via a standard I2C bus ( SDA, SCL ). It also uses EN1, EN2 , and FB (Feedback) pins for basic operation. | This I2C interface is key for repair. Dedicated programming tools exist (e.g., TJKJ-A1 ) that connect to these lines to directly reprogram the PMIC. | A datasheet isn't just about numbers; it’s about limits
